How To Write Resume For Certified Court Interpreter

  • Highlight your certification from the National Court Interpreters Association (NCIA) and any other relevant professional organizations.
  • Quantify your experience by providing specific examples of cases or projects where you have successfully interpreted.
  • Showcase your language proficiency by including samples of your work or providing references who can attest to your skills.
  • Emphasize your understanding of legal terminology and procedures, as well as your ability to work effectively in a courtroom setting.
  • Demonstrate your commitment to ethical and professional standards by highlighting your adherence to industry best practices.

Essential Experience Highlights for a Strong Certified Court Interpreter Resume

To create a compelling Certified Court Interpreter resume, it’s essential to highlight specific responsibilities and achievements in your experience section. The following examples can significantly enhance your resume’s impact and increase your chances of securing an interview.
  • Providing real-time interpretation services in legal proceedings, ensuring accurate communication between non-English speaking parties and the legal system.
  • Interpreting complex legal jargon, technical terminologies, and colloquialisms to facilitate effective communication and understanding.
  • Adhering to strict ethical guidelines and confidentiality standards while handling sensitive legal information and proceedings.
  • Maintaining composure and neutrality while interpreting in highly emotional and adversarial situations.
  • Collaborating with attorneys, judges, witnesses, and other parties involved in the legal proceedings to ensure smooth communication flow.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Certified Court Interpreter

  • What is the role of a Certified Court Interpreter?

    A Certified Court Interpreter is responsible for providing accurate and impartial interpretation services in legal proceedings, ensuring effective communication between non-English speaking parties and the legal system.

  • What are the key skills required for a Certified Court Interpreter?

    Certified Court Interpreters must be proficient in both English and at least one other language, have a deep understanding of legal terminology and procedures, and be able to maintain composure and neutrality in challenging situations.

  • How do I become a Certified Court Interpreter?

    To become a Certified Court Interpreter, you typically need to pass a certification exam administered by a recognized organization, such as the National Court Interpreters Association (NCIA).

  • What is the job outlook for Certified Court Interpreters?

    The job outlook for Certified Court Interpreters is expected to grow faster than average, as there is an increasing demand for language interpretation services in legal proceedings.

  • What are the earning potential for Certified Court Interpreters?

    The earning potential for Certified Court Interpreters can vary depending on experience, location, and employer.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ual salary for interpreters and translators was $52,330 in May 2021.

  • What are the benefits of being a Certified Court Interpreter?

    Being a Certified Court Interpreter can offer a rewarding career with opportunities to make a meaningful impact on the justice system. It also provides competitive earning potential and job security.
